Skip to main content
Connecting Salesforce to Flowla lets you automatically pull in your deals, contacts, and company data, so you can personalize rooms at scale and trigger powerful workflows based on CRM activity. Once it’s set up, the connection is active for your entire team on Flowla.

Why Integrate Salesforce with Flowla?

Connecting Salesforce to Flowla gives you a powerful two-way sync between your CRM and your customer-facing rooms. At its core, the integration allows you to:
  • Pull in CRM data to personalize rooms automatically
  • Push Flowla engagement (views, form submissions, completions) back into Salesforce
  • Keep everything aligned across tools and teams, without manual work
When paired with automated workflows, it becomes even more powerful:You can trigger actions based on CRM events, auto-update Salesforce when buyers take key actions, and build an always-on sales system. (All your deal room activity synced to Salesforce)

What You Can Do With the Integration

By combining the two-way sync with automated workflows, you can: Personalize rooms automatically using Salesforce fields like company name, logo, contact info
Trigger workflows from CRM events, like opportunity stage changes or creation
Push engagement data (e.g. form submitted, section unlocked) back to Salesforce
Update CRM fields or create tasks based on room activity using workflows
Keep Salesforce as your source of truth, without needing manual copy-paste
Power your entire revenue process, from deal creation to onboarding, with integrated data and actions
Learn more about building automated workflows to connect room activity with your CRM.

How to set it up

1. Add Flowla as a trusted URL
  • Go to: Setup > CSP Trusted Sites
  • Add: https://app.flowla.com
  • Check all required CSP Directives (as shown in the screenshot)
2. Connect your Salesforce account
In Flowla:
  • Go to Integrations
  • Click Connect under Salesforce
  • Complete the authentication flow
3. Install the Flowla Salesforce Package
Use this link to install the package for All Users:👉 Install Flowla for Salesforce
4. Add Flowla to Your Opportunity Page
  1. Go to Sales Console App
  2. Open any opportunity
  3. Click the ⚙️ icon → Edit Page
  • Drag and drop the Flowla Aura Component onto the layout
  • Click Save
  • Activate the page as App Default
5. Assign the Flowla API Permission Set
  • Go to Setup > Permission Sets
  • Open Flowla API
  • Click Manage Assignments
  • Add the right users (e.g. Sales or CS team)
6. Set up External Credentials
  • Search for Named Credentials
  • Go to the External Credentials tab
  • Find Flowla API
  • Edit FlowlaAPIPrincipal
  • Add your API key under Authentication Parameters
📝 You can find your Flowla API key by going to:​Integrations > Salesforce > Settings & more

Build Salesforce workflows

Create automated workflows triggered by Salesforce events like opportunity stage changes.